Vernon "Blake" Williams

August 1, 1953 — August 24, 2018

Blake’s Life journey began August 1st, 1953 in Portage la Prairie and his Heavenly journey was made August 24th, 2018.

Bud, my heart is broken and the ache is tremendous, but it gives me, our son and “daughter” Raegan comfort to have been with you ‘til the end.

Life is not fair sometimes – after his super courageous battle, “My Bud” and Adam’s “Bean” left us way too soon. Now we reflect on our countless special times and memories to prevail over the times of anger and sadness. Our enormous amount of love and devotion was felt by him and we know he felt it too.

Blake will be waiting in Heaven for me to join him, but until then he will be sharing Heaven with his parents Bunny and Evelyn, sister Darlene and brother Vaughn. He will also be welcomed by his favorite mother-in-law Jean Kissock. Anyone who knew Blake, also knows he’ll catch up on that dusty trail with his pal John Wayne.

Left with painful hearts on Earth are his sister Patty, sister Sandra, brother Scott, father-in-law Jack Kissock, and so many countless in-laws, cousins, nieces and nephews, co-workers and friends.

Fly High Bud – you took My Love with you. I will always treasure our life together – you made it wonderful.

TO KNOW HIM … WAS TO LOVE HIM

As per Blake and Patty’s wishes, there will be no funeral. In lieu of flowers, gifts honoring Blake’s memory would be heartfelt appreciated. These gifts may be made to CancerCare Manitoba, 675 McDermot Avenue Winnipeg, MB R3E 0V9, Central Plains Cancer Services, 318 Saskatchewan Ave. E., Portage la Prairie, MB R1N 0K8, Heart & Stroke Foundation of Manitoba, 1379 Kenaston Boulevard Winnipeg, MB R3P 2T5, or Maple Grove Cemetery, RR3, Site 42, Comp 6, Portage la Prairie, MB, R1N 3A3.

A tree will be planted in memory and cared for by McKenzies Portage Funeral Chapel.
